Pierre Faa Ap, Sd vs Prado Climate & Distance Between

Uruguay flag
  • The distance between Pierre Faa Ap, Sd, Usa and Prado, Uruguay is approximately 9,872 km or 6,135 mi.
  • To reach Pierre Faa Ap, Sd in this distance one would set out from Prado bearing 330.1°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Pierre Faa Ap, Sd bearing 325.1° or NW .
  • Pierre Faa Ap, Sd has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Prado has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Pierre Faa Ap, Sd is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Prado is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 8.4 °C (15.1°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.7 °C (37.3°F) more in Pierre Faa Ap, Sd.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 627.9 mm (24.7 in) less which is equivalent to 627.9 l/m² (15.41 US gal/ft²) or 6,279,000 l/ha (671,267 US gal/ac) less. About 3/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.8° lower in Pierre Faa Ap, Sd than in Prado.
